Output 8059c507bccc52b23651b14ff79df2d1539d9720bf17de75a47e98cf0a7c0e99:1

value
12403797
script pubkey
OP_0 OP_PUSHBYTES_20 c3efd5589ef5ac439e05ea2aaf31770125dbad03
address
bc1qc0ha2ky77kky88s9ag427vthqyjahtgrdpypqz
transaction
8059c507bccc52b23651b14ff79df2d1539d9720bf17de75a47e98cf0a7c0e99
spent
false

14 Sat Ranges